Business Profile Performance API 现已发布!必须执行迁移工作。
查看弃用时间表以及相关说明,了解如何从旧版 v4 API 迁移到新的 v1 API。
请填写此调查问卷,帮助我们更好地了解您支持哪些商家的地点、菜单和菜品属性,从而帮助我们改善食品菜单体验

Method: accounts.locations.verify

使用集合让一切井井有条 根据您的偏好保存内容并对其进行分类。

开始对营业地点执行验证流程。

HTTP 请求

POST https://mybusiness.googleapis.com/v4/{name=accounts/*/locations/*}:verify

网址采用 gRPC 转码语法。

路径参数

参数
name

string

要验证的营业地点的资源名称。

请求正文

请求正文中包含结构如下的数据:

JSON 表示法
{
  "method": enum (VerificationMethod),
  "languageCode": string,
  "context": {
    object (ServiceBusinessContext)
  },

  // Union field RequestData can be only one of the following:
  "emailInput": {
    object (EmailInput)
  },
  "addressInput": {
    object (AddressInput)
  },
  "phoneInput": {
    object (PhoneInput)
  }
  // End of list of possible types for union field RequestData.
}
字段
method

enum (VerificationMethod)

验证方法。

languageCode

string

BCP 47 语言代码,代表验证流程中使用的语言。

context

object (ServiceBusinessContext)

用于验证服务类商家的额外背景信息。对于业务类型为 CUSTOMER_LOCATION_ONLY 的营业地点而言是必需的。对于 ADDRESS 验证,地址会用于寄送明信片。对于其他方法,它应该与传递给 location.fetchVerificationOptions 的方法相同。如果为其他类型的营业地点设置此字段,则抛出 INVALID_ARGUMENT。

联合字段 RequestData。除显示数据外,特定方法的用户输入数据。数据必须与请求的方法匹配。如果不需要任何数据,请将其留空。RequestData 只能是下列其中一项:
emailInput

object (EmailInput)

EMAIL 方法的输入。

addressInput

object (AddressInput)

ADDRESS 方法的输入。

phoneInput

object (PhoneInput)

PHONE_CALL/SMS 方法的输入

响应正文

如果成功,响应正文将包含结构如下的数据:

Verifications.VerifyLocation 的响应消息。

JSON 表示法
{
  "verification": {
    object (Verification)
  }
}
字段
verification

object (Verification)

已创建的验证请求。

授权范围

需要以下 OAuth 范围之一:

  • https://www.googleapis.com/auth/plus.business.manage
  • https://www.googleapis.com/auth/business.manage

如需了解详情,请参阅 OAuth 2.0 概览

电子邮件输入

用于 EMAIL 验证的输入。

JSON 表示法
{
  "emailAddress": string
}
字段
emailAddress

string

相应 PIN 码应发送到的电子邮件地址。

电子邮件地址必须是 locations.fetchVerificationOptions 提供的地址之一。如果 EmailVerificationData 将 isUserNameEditable 设置为 true,则客户端可以指定不同的用户名(本地部分),但必须与域名匹配。

地址输入

用于验证 ADDRESS。

JSON 表示法
{
  "mailerContactName": string
}
字段
mailerContactName

string

邮件应该发送到的联系人姓名。

电话输入

用于进行 PHONE_CALL/短信验证。

JSON 表示法
{
  "phoneNumber": string
}
字段
phoneNumber

string

应向其拨打电话或发送短信的电话号码。必须是有效选项中的电话号码之一。